Stay warm in the Trespass Unisex Super Soft Long Sleeve Thermal Top Unify. Made with a blend of 60% cotton and 40% polyester, this navy top locks in heat to keep you cosy in colder climates. Ideal for outdoor enthusiasts seeking comfort and warmth on their adventures.
Super Soft Material: Experience unparalleled comfort with the supersoft medium weight waffle fabric that feels gentle against your skin.Reinforced Seams: Enjoy enhanced durability and longevity thanks to the reinforced seams that prevent fraying or tearing during outdoor activities.Thermal Insulation: Keep yourself comfortably warm in chilly conditions with the thermal feature trapping body heat for optimal warmth retention.
